diff --git a/kdc/kdc_locl.h b/kdc/kdc_locl.h index fadbbe4b9..6aff1d74c 100644 --- a/kdc/kdc_locl.h +++ b/kdc/kdc_locl.h @@ -77,7 +77,7 @@ #include "hdb.h" -extern require_enc_timestamp; +extern require_preauth; extern sig_atomic_t exit_flag; extern struct timeval now; diff --git a/kdc/kerberos5.c b/kdc/kerberos5.c index f30afdf09..b61b6499e 100644 --- a/kdc/kerberos5.c +++ b/kdc/kerberos5.c @@ -212,7 +212,7 @@ as_rep(krb5_context context, } } /* XXX */ - if(found_pa == 0 && require_enc_timestamp) + if(found_pa == 0 && require_preauth) goto use_pa; /* We come here if we found a pa-enc-timestamp, but if there was some problem with it, other than too large skew */ @@ -221,7 +221,7 @@ as_rep(krb5_context context, e_text = NULL; goto out; } - }else if (require_enc_timestamp) { + }else if (require_preauth) { PA_DATA foo; u_char buf[16]; size_t len;